Choosing a Safe Area



When picking a place for your glamping camping tent, focus on flat ground free of rocks and particles to make sure a safe setup. This step is important to prevent any kind of potential risks during your exterior remain. Before settling on an area, take a moment to check the location for any sharp objects or irregular surface that could present a danger to the security of your tent. By picking a degree surface area, you not only guarantee a comfy resting arrangement but likewise reduce the risk of mishaps such as tripping or the camping tent collapsing.

Additionally, look for a spot that offers all-natural security from elements like solid winds or potential flooding. Positioning your tent near an all-natural windbreak, such as a line of trees or a hillside, can secure it from gusts and boost your general camping experience.

In addition, avoid setting up your outdoor tents at the end of hillsides or inclines to avoid water accumulation in case of rain. Focusing on a secure and appropriate area for your glamping outdoor tents establishes the stage for a safe and secure and pleasurable outdoor journey.

Establishing Secure Anchoring



Guarantee your glamping outdoor tents is safely anchored to the ground to avoid it from moving or falling down during your exterior keep. Begin by selecting ideal securing options based on the surface where you'll be establishing your outdoor tents.

If you're camping in a sandy location, think about making use of sandbags or risks specifically designed for loose soil. For rough terrain, choose sturdy stakes that can stand up to tougher ground. Once you've selected the right anchoring tools, drive them into the ground at a 45-degree angle away from the tent.

Ensure to position them whatsoever edges and alongside the outdoor tents to distribute the tension evenly. After safeguarding the stakes, tighten the guy lines connected to them to offer added assistance and security. Consistently examine the stress on the lines throughout your remain, particularly after solid winds or rain.

Implementing Wildlife Safety Measures



To shield on your own and your glamping experience, take preventative measures to carry out wildlife precaution in the area where you'll be staying. Before establishing your glamping camping tent, acquaint on your own with the neighborhood wildlife varieties that may posture a threat.



Keep grocery store firmly in animal-proof containers and dispose of trash effectively to avoid attracting undesirable wildlife. When discovering the environments, make noise to sharp animals of your presence and stay clear of unexpected them. It's crucial to regard wildlife by observing from a secure distance and never coming close to or feeding them.
